Leylani finished the weekend averaging 4.7 blocks a game. Leylani can guard many positions due to her length and defensive ability. She can play above the rim due to her athleticism. She holds her defensive position well and can switch to perimeter players if needed. She has the amazing ability to rotate during defensive schemes. She has a strong frame, which gives offensive players nightmares because she is hard to score against. She brings a tough, strong physical presence to the floor. She will provide rebounding and physical defense at the next level.

Abraham averaged 10.6 points in 24 games, providing Gainesville with a consistent interior presence on both ends. She runs the floor hard in transition, occupies the middle lane, and finishes through contact with strength and control around the rim. Defensively, Abraham serves as a paint protector, using her length and timing to alter shots and secure rebounds. She delivered key performances in postseason play, including 8 points in a Region 6B quarterfinal win over Stafford and a physical presence in the Cedar Run District Championship. A 1st Team All-District selection, Abraham’s size, physicality, and Division I caliber continue to raise Gainesville’s standard.
